Why Spring Loaded Latch Pin is Necessary
From my experience, a spring loaded latch pin is absolutely essential for ensuring secure and reliable fastening in various applications. I’ve found that its ability to automatically lock in place saves me a lot of time and effort compared to traditional pins or bolts that require manual tightening. This automatic engagement means I don’t have to worry about the pin slipping out unexpectedly, which gives me peace of mind, especially in dynamic or heavy-duty environments.
Additionally, the spring mechanism provides consistent tension, which helps absorb vibrations and movement. In my work, this reduces wear and tear on connected parts and prevents loosening over time. The ease of use is another big advantage; I can quickly insert or remove the pin with one hand, making adjustments or maintenance much faster. Overall, the spring loaded latch pin combines safety, efficiency, and convenience in a way that I’ve come to rely on daily.
My Buying Guides on Spring Loaded Latch Pin
When I first needed a spring loaded latch pin, I quickly realized there are quite a few things to consider to get the right one for my project. Let me share what I learned to help you pick the best latch pin for your needs.
Understand What a Spring Loaded Latch Pin Is
Before buying, I made sure I understood the basic function. A spring loaded latch pin is a fastener that uses a spring mechanism to lock or secure parts quickly and easily. It’s often used in machinery, trailers, gates, and other equipment where quick release and secure locking are important.
Consider the Material
One of the first things I checked was the material. These latch pins come in stainless steel, zinc-plated steel, or sometimes aluminum. I preferred stainless steel because it’s corrosion-resistant and durable, especially since my project is outdoors and exposed to weather.
Check the Size and Diameter
The size matters a lot. I measured the hole or the part where the pin would fit to make sure I got the right diameter and length. Too small, and it won’t hold securely; too big, and it won’t fit. Most sellers provide detailed dimensions, so I always compared those with my measurements.
Look at the Spring Strength
The spring inside the latch pin controls how tightly it holds. I wanted a spring that’s strong enough to keep the pin in place even with vibrations or movement but not so stiff that it’s hard to release. Sometimes the product description mentions spring force, so I looked for that or customer reviews commenting on ease of use.
Type of Handle or Grip
I found that the handle design can make a big difference in comfort and ease of operation. Some latch pins have a T-handle, some have a ring, and others have a knurled grip. I chose a design that was easy for me to pull and push without slipping, especially since I might wear gloves while working.
Verify Load Capacity and Application
Depending on what I was securing, I made sure the latch pin could handle the load or stress. Some pins are designed for heavy-duty use, while others are for lighter tasks. Checking the manufacturer’s specs or user reviews helped me confirm suitability.
Corrosion Resistance and Environmental Factors
Since my project is exposed to rain and humidity, corrosion resistance was key. Stainless steel pins or those with special coatings like zinc plating worked best. If you’re using the pin indoors or in dry conditions, this might be less critical.
Price and Warranty
I compared prices but didn’t just go for the cheapest option. Sometimes spending a little more means better quality and longer life. Also, I checked if the seller offered a warranty or return policy, giving me peace of mind in case the pin didn’t meet my expectations.
Read Customer Reviews
Finally, I always read reviews from other buyers. Their experiences gave me insights into durability, ease of use, and any issues I might face. It’s a great way to avoid surprises.
